Test plan for the Lattermark timetable solver, cycle 14. Scope: constraint relaxation under teacher-absence scenarios and room double-booking detection. Run the nightly suite against the Hollowbrook District fixture set; expect all 412 cases green. Known flaky case: split-shift lunch blocks — rerun twice before paging anyone. If the solver exceeds the 90-second budget on the large fixture, capture the heap dump and attach it to the cycle ticket. The harness authenticates against the staging scheduler API using the credential below.

session JWT of yawep-yawep = eyJhbGciOiJIUzI1NiIsInR5cCI6IkpXVCJ9.eyJzdWIiOiI3pWF3_In0.aXYsHiog

// Driver-assignment heuristic for the Pelicargo dispatch service.
// We score candidate drivers on proximity, recent-load fatigue, and
// acceptance history, then greedily assign within each zone tick.
// Tweaked after the Marlow Junction pilot showed too many long hops;
// raising the distance penalty fixed it without hurting fill rate.
// For the weekly sync: the current knobs are listed here.

limits module of tafop-hahop:
WEIGHTS = {
    "julmir": 223,
    "belox": 987,
    "lamion": 470,
    "pelath": 609,
    "fraok": 1010,
    "eliion": 343,
    "drudor": 342,
}

Runbook 4.2 — Read-Replica Lag Alarm (Cartwheel cluster). If replica lag exceeds 30 seconds during a release window, pause the rollout immediately; do not proceed to the canary stage. Verify whether a long-running migration is holding the replication stream, and confirm replica disk I/O before considering a failover. Detailed diagnostic queries and the failover decision tree are maintained on the page below.

dashboard of yahaf-kajep = https://jira.zemvarsys.internal/display/projects/browse/browse/a08b